VA awards $19.3M for IT services to Innovative Management & Technology Approaches Inc

Contract Overview

Contract Amount: $19,312,421 ($19.3M)

Contractor: Innovative Management & Technology Approaches Inc

Awarding Agency: Department of Veterans Affairs

Start Date: 2011-10-01

End Date: 2017-03-31

Contract Duration: 2,008 days

Daily Burn Rate: $9.6K/day

Competition Type: FULL AND OPEN COMPETITION

Number of Offers Received: 2

Pricing Type: FIRM FIXED PRICE

Sector: IT

Official Description: BUSINESS PROCESS MODELING 3/4/16 CORRECTING RECORD TO FORCE PSC AND NAICS TO MODIFICATION. CW
